## Further reading

The Bramblekit component library follows semver-ish rules, but security patches land as patch releases on every supported major line, so check which versions are actually pinned downstream. Deprecations get a two-release grace window. For the full versioning policy and the patch backport matrix, see the page linked below.

dashboard of kafop-yagep = https://jira.zemvarsys.internal/pages/pages/pages/display/cc87

Alert: relevance-tuning-notes-stale. This fires when the search relevance tuning notes in the Lanternquery repo have not been updated within 30 days of a ranking-weight change. Reviewers should block merges that adjust weights in rankconfig.toml without a corresponding notes entry. If the alert appears mistaken or the notes were updated elsewhere, contact the search quality owner at the address below.

escalation mailbox, bafog-fafog: ulador@paliqlabs.internal

Medical-cooler transport — Fennwick field clinic. Quick reference for records folks: every cooler leaving for the Fennwick site gets a transport sheet, a temperature logger, and a seal check before it goes anywhere. Log the seal number and departure time in the transit book, and note who carried it out of the building. When you hand the cooler to the courier, pass along this instruction exactly:

dispatch memo: the eliok quenok courier leaves the sorael aldath belion tammir casix gileth queniel jorath ledger at gate 9299 under passcode 897989

## Runbook: hunting leaked file descriptors in Burrowlark

If the Burrowlark ingest workers start hitting the fd ceiling again, grab a descriptor snapshot before anything restarts — otherwise the evidence vanishes. Run the `fdsweep` helper against each worker pod and diff against yesterday's baseline. Heads up for security review: the sweep tool authenticates to the Pinefold metrics vault, so the env file on the bastion needs its token present. That vault token goes on the very next line.

sealed setting: VAULT_KEY20=c8ea1e419912889df6b4